Why Recycling Matters More Than Ever
The world generates billions of tons of waste annually. A significant portion of this waste ends up in landfills, where it can take decadesor even centuriesto decompose.
Effective recycling programs offer several benefits.
- Reduce landfill waste
- Conserve natural resources
- Lower greenhouse gas emissions
- Save energy during manufacturing
- Create jobs within the recycling industry
- Support sustainable economic growth
Organizations and recycling platforms that prioritize efficient waste recovery play an increasingly important role in addressing these issues.

The Growing Importance of Electronic Waste Recycling
Electronic waste (e-waste) is one of the fastest-growing waste streams globally. Smartphones, laptops, televisions, and other electronic devices contain valuable materials that can be recovered through specialized recycling processes.
Many modern recycling initiatives now prioritize the following:
Data Security
Consumers and businesses want assurance that sensitive information is securely destroyed before devices are recycled.
Precious Metal Recovery
Electronic devices contain valuable metals such as
- Gold
- Silver
- Copper
- Palladium
The recovery of these materials reduces the need for additional mining operations.
Environmental Protection
Proper e-waste recycling prevents hazardous substances from contaminating the soil and water supplies.

Best Practices for Effective Recycling
Whether you are an individual or a business, adopting a few simple habits can improve recycling outcomes.
Separate Materials Properly
Recyclable items should not be mixed with general waste whenever possible.
Clean Recyclables
Rinsing containers before disposal reduces contamination and improves the processing efficiency.
Follow Local Recycling Guidelines
Different regions accept different materials; therefore, always check the local requirements.
Reduce Before You Recycle
The most sustainable approach is to reduce consumption and reuse products before recycling them.
Challenges Facing the Recycling Industry
Despite significant progress, recycling programs face several challenges.
Contamination
Food residues and non-recyclable materials can reduce the effectiveness of recycling operations.
Market Fluctuations
The value of recycled materials can vary depending on the global supply and demand.
Public Awareness
Many people remain uncertain about which materials can be recycled.
Infrastructure Limitations
Some regions still lack sufficient recycling facilities and collection systems to support recycling.
Addressing these challenges requires collaboration among the government, businesses, and consumers.
